
It looks like the long-in-development Venom movie will take place within the same universe as the latest Spidey film, The Amazing Spider-Man, and possibly feature some of the same characters and actors. That’s according to the producing team Avi Arad and Matthew Tolmach, who tell Hollywood.com that they’re developing the new Venom to live in the same world as the new Spider-Man.
Arad and Tolmach also revealed that the Venom film will focus on Eddie Brock, the first version of the character. Brock was played by Topher Grace in Spider-Man 3, but the new film will likely feature another actor in the role. There’s no word yet on when the project will begin shooting. It’ll be helmed by Chronicle director Josh Trank.
